The lake view room makes people happy, so what about the "tiger view room"?

  According to the cover news report, on January 18, it was reported that a tiger viewing room appeared in a zoo hotel in Nantong, Jiangsu.

Judging from the shooting video, the tiger dwelling is only separated from the viewing room by a layer of glass, and the area of ​​the glass is huge, which completely exposes the room to the tiger's sight, causing online controversy about safety issues and animal welfare.

The staff said that the glass uses explosion-proof glass to ensure safety, and the hotel has not yet been put into use.

  Come to think of it, the construction of the "Tiger View Room" has fully considered the safety, and the personal safety of tourists should not be a big problem.

It is estimated that there are not many people who want to go hunting, although this so-called adventure is actually made.

However, for tigers, the "Tiger View Room" is a big problem.

  In nature, wild tigers require huge habitats.

We have put tigers in a zoo, which has greatly compressed their living space. Now we have to put them in a place the size of a palm, and force them to "sleep" with humans, which undoubtedly goes against their natural instincts.

Over time, the tiger's body and mind will inevitably have problems.

  Yang Yi, the manager of Wuhan Zoo, said that from the tiger breeding environment in the video, there is no natural element, and the tiger is pacing back and forth in front of the glass, "This behavior is called stereotyped behavior, which shows that there is a problem with the tiger's psychology. of."

  The purpose of establishing a zoo is to protect animals, conduct research, and popularize the value and significance of animal protection to the public.

The "World Zoo and Aquarium Conservation Strategy (2005)" formulated by the World Association of Zoos and Aquariums summarizes the functions of modern zoos into comprehensive conservation and conservation education, and conservation education is the primary function of zoos, "serving the public and giving full play to the role of zoos. The proper role of social welfare undertakings” is the foundation of every zoo’s survival.

  This positioning determines that no matter who invests in the construction of the zoo, its public welfare will not change.

Its business behavior and daily management are subject to the constraints of its public welfare.

The "Tiger View House" is so blatantly aimed at making money without sacrificing the purpose of protection, which goes against the original intention of building the zoo.

Wildlife conservation is a social resource and should not be reduced to a money-making tool for some people or some institutions.

It is not that the zoo cannot carry out business activities, but it should be out of the need to maintain its own good operation and be beneficial to the protection of animals. If it deviates from this purpose, it is putting the cart before the horse.
